Corrective Action Plan <br />Situations which come to the attention of, or are reported to, the OCFA <br />EMS Section Battalion Chief and which appear to constitute a Contractor <br />service or performance deficiency or substantial inadequacy, as <br />determined by the OCFA, shall be immediately investigated by the OCFA. <br />An example of such situation might be the Contractor's failure to achieve <br />at least a 90% response time performance in any single Code category for <br />a quarterly reporting period. At the discretion of the OCFA, a Corrective <br />Action Plan may be imposed on the Contractor to correct identified and <br />verified performance deficiencies and inadequacies. The OCFA <br />authorized representative shall meet to develop a written Corrective Action <br />Plan (CAP) within fifteen (15) working days of the identification and <br />verification of the service or performance deficiency, or substantial <br />inadequacy, in accordance with the following CAP requirements: <br />i. CAP Format <br />The CAP shall describe the following: <br />(1) The service or performance deficiency, or substantial inadequacy <br />shall be identified; and <br />(2) The method by which Contractor is to correct the service or <br />performance deficiency, or substantial inadequacy, shall be <br />outlined. Contractor shall sign the CAP, thereby agreeing to the <br />corrective action set forth in the CAP, with any areas of <br />disagreement noted in writing. A copy of the signed CAP shall be <br />furnished to Contractor at the conclusion of the CAP meeting. <br />ii.
